Counselor Corner
February guidance lessons will be about respecting differences. We must teach our students that different does not equal bad. For example, another student may bring a lunch to school that looks very different from your lunch. If you respect differences you could ask about it and be open to learning. Sometimes students are quick to say “What is that?...it looks weird.”
